Senanga, nestled in Zambia's Western Province, offers a serene escape for those seeking nature and adventure. Situated on the eastern bank of the Zambezi River, it is a prime spot for fishing and exploring the rich wildlife of the Barotse Floodplain. The town is a gateway to nearby attractions such as Sioma Ngwezi National Park and Ngonye Falls, making it a perfect base for outdoor enthusiasts. With recent infrastructure improvements, including the Kaunga Lyeti Bridge and upgraded roads, access to Senanga has never been easier. The annual Zambia Sport Fishing Competition is a highlight, drawing participants from near and far.
